The current measurements are calibrated to a common temperature using the following relationship: $$I_{temp}^{SF} = \left ( \frac{T_{ref}}{T_{meas}} \right )^{2} \times e^{eE_{g}^{Si} \frac{T_{ref}-T_{meas}}{2 k_{B} T_{ref} T_{meas} }} $$ where \( T_{ref} \) is the reference temperature, \( T_{meas} \) is the temperatured measured during the test, \( e \) is the electric charge, \( E_{g}^{Si} \) is the band gap energy of silicon, and \( k_{B} \) is the Boltzman constant
